WebGraphing Inequalities To graph an inequality, treat the <, ≤, >, or ≥ sign as an = sign, and graph the equation. If the inequality is < or >, graph the equation as a dotted line.If the inequality is ≤ or ≥, graph the equation as a solid … WebGraph f (x) = 7 sin x and g (x) = 5 sin x − 1 in the same rectangular coordinate system for 0 ≤ x ≤ 2 π.
